Professional installation ensures that surveillance cameras are positioned for maximum effectiveness and durability. Local service providers can advise on the best camera types-such as dome, bullet, or PTZ cameras-and help determine the most strategic locations for installation. They also handle the technical aspects of wiring, power supply, and network connectivity, which are crucial for reliable operation. Whether for outdoor monitoring of driveways and yards or indoor surveillance of entry points and common areas, experienced contractors can tailor solutions to meet specific property needs. This ensures homeowners receive a security setup that is both functional and unobtrusive, fitting seamlessly into their property’s layout.
The overview below groups typical Surveillance Camera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Basic camera repairs or minor installations typically cost between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, especially for single-camera setups or simple mounting tasks.
Standard Installations - Installing multiple cameras or upgrading existing systems usually ranges from $600 to $2,000. Most projects in this category are straightforward and stay within this mid-tier price band.
Full System Setup - Larger, more complex surveillance systems with extensive coverage can range from $2,000 to $5,000. Fewer projects reach this level, often involving detailed wiring and advanced features.
Complete Overhauls - Major overhauls or custom security solutions can exceed $5,000, depending on the scale and technology involved. These higher-end projects are less common but handled by experienced local contractors for larger properties or commercial sites.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of surveillance cameras can local contractors install? Local service providers can install a variety of surveillance cameras, including dome, bullet, PTZ, and wireless systems, tailored to meet different security needs.
Are surveillance cameras suitable for both residential and commercial properties? Yes, local contractors offer installation services for both homes and businesses, providing solutions suited to each environment.
What should I consider when choosing a surveillance camera system? Factors such as coverage area, camera resolution, connectivity options, and integration with existing security systems are important considerations handled by local pros.
Do local contractors offer surveillance camera installation for outdoor and indoor locations? Yes, installation services typically include options for both outdoor and indoor surveillance camera setups.
How do local service providers ensure proper placement of surveillance cameras? They evaluate property layout, identify vulnerable areas, and recommend strategic camera placement to maximize coverage and effectiveness.
